How much do med matrix j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 23, 2026, the average hourly pay for med matrix in the United States is $37.30,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$28.85 and $46.39 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Medical Laboratory Technician,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Medical Laboratory Technician, you need a solid background in laboratory science, attention to detail, and typically an associate degree in clinical laboratory science or related field. Familiarity with laboratory information systems (LIS), automated analyzers, and quality control protocols is crucial. Strong problem-solving skills, teamwork, and effective communication set outstanding technicians apart. These skills are critical to ensuring accurate test results, maintaining lab safety, and supporting patient diagnoses.

Job description

Position Summary

The Medical Director, USMA Respiratory, will work as part of the Medical Matrix Team responsible for the medical impact of an asset. The Medical Director helps develop the medical strategy and executes MA tactics for a Key Asset.

If you seek a role where your medical affairs leadership acumen supporting key therapeutic areas would align for your career aspirations, then this could be the opportunity for you!


Responsibilities
This role will provide YOU the opportunity to lead key activities to progress YOUR career. These responsibilities include some of the following:

  • Responsible for helping to develop US medical strategy and perspective, ensuring medical strategy and plans are aligned with commercial asset strategy where appropriate.

  • Contribute to the cross-functional Medical Matrix Team to tailor / adapt global asset strategy for US specific customer needs and environment. Contribute to strategic oversight of US Tactical Plans aligned to strategy.

  • Gain strategic alignment of asset positioning and evidence planning with the overall therapeutic portfolio and disease area strategies.

  • Engage with external communities to advance scientific and medical understanding including the appropriate development and use of our medicines, the management of disease, and patient care. Coordinate with the US MSLs, GMAL on joint global and US engagement of top US based EEswhere appropriate.

  • Works to understand the evolving healthcare environment (provider/expert) and payer landscapes and help to translate that working knowledge into a plan.

  • Reviews, synthesizes, and analyses clinical trial and RWE data and translates data into actionable plans at the product level.

  • Develops product strategy for local Medical Advisory Board and Expert Panel meetings and Consultancies, Medical Grants, and Medical Publications.

  • Supports Medical Information on FAQs and standard response letters

  • Follows sound medical governance for all activities.

GlaxoSmithKline is a globally recognized pharmaceutical and healthcare company based in Philadelphia, PA, USA. Originated from a merger between Glaxo Wellcome and SmithKline Beecham in 2000, the company excels in the pharmaceutical industry and holds a leading position in making medicines, vaccines, and consumer healthcare products. GSK's mission is to improve the quality of human life by enabling people to do more, feel better, and live longer. They adhere to core values of transparency, integrity, respect for people, and patient-focus, reflecting in their endeavors to conduct research and deliver innovative healthcare solutions to patients and consumers worldwide.
